Alzheimer's disease therapeutic research: the path forward

Paul S Aisen Alzheimer's Research & Therapy 2009, 1:2 (9 July 2009)

Despite recent negative trial results, a clear path forward is emerging in Alzheimer’s disease therapeutic research using newly available tools to allow the study of new treatments at earlier stages in the disease process.

Beyond mild cognitive impairment: vascular cognitive impairment, no dementia (VCIND)

Blossom CM Stephan, Fiona E Matthews, Kay-Tee Khaw, Carole Dufouil, Carol Brayne Alzheimer's Research & Therapy 2009, 1:4 (9 July 2009)

Stephan et al. review the concept of ‘vascular cognitive impairment, no dementia’ (VCIND) and its application for screening individuals at increased risk of dementia secondary to vascular disease and its risk factors.

Angiotensins and Alzheimer's disease: a bench to bedside overview

Patrick G Kehoe Alzheimer's Research & Therapy 2009, 1:3 (9 July 2009)

Kehoe proposes angiotensins and associated enzymatic pathways as important mediators of recognized but undefined links between blood pressure and Alzheimer’s disease.
